Install dependencies:
npm install
bower install
Run in dev server to have automatic reload and source convertion:
grunt debug
To build extension run:
grunt build

Issues:
- Ractive is not CSP (https://developer.chrome.com/apps/contentSecurityPolicy) complient. Some functionality of Ractive is not working in Chrome. Consider using something else
- When switching between tabs, browser actions shows the number of comments for active page (1 pt)
- Urls should be cleaned: http://ya.ru, https://ya.ru/, https://ya.ru/?x=1 and http://ya.ru/#about are the same urls (2 pt)
- Only comments for current url is shown (2 pt)
- User can not leave a comment without entering credentials (1 pt)
- User avatar is taken from gravatar.com service. (2 pt)
- Comment publication date is shown (1 pt)
- Comment author name is shown (1 pt)
- Once user credentials are entered they are store in browser memory (localStorage), no need to enter it every time (2 pt)
- If you dont implement comment pagination, then show all of them (1 pt)
- Beautiful is better than ugly: make UI on worse then in a video (2 pt)
